Firstly, let’s consider the mechanical aspect of the problem. A faulty starter motor or ignition system can lead to vibrations as soon as you turn the key. These systems are responsible for providing power to start the engine. If either component fails, it may cause excessive shaking during startup. Additionally, worn-out parts such as spark plugs, fuel injectors, or even the battery itself can contribute to instability when starting the vehicle.

Another angle to examine is the environmental factors at play. Cold weather conditions can sometimes cause engines to vibrate more than usual due to decreased lubrication and increased resistance to movement.
